Hiland Dairy Foods LLC is an EPA Toxics Release Inventory reporter in Dallas, TX, in the food sector. It reported 20.5K lbs of releases across 3 chemicals in 2023, and 59.0K lbs in total across its 2019-2023 reporting years. That ranks 5,758 of 25,986 TRI facilities nationwide by cumulative reported pounds, counting each facility over however many years it has filed. Annual disclosure change
What changed: EPA TRI 2023 reporting year
- Hiland Dairy Foods LLC's total reported releases rose from 6.4 thousand lb in 2022 to 20.5 thousand lb in 2023, based on EPA TRI filings.
- Hiland Dairy Foods LLC's air releases rose from 0 lb in 2022 to 17.3 thousand lb in 2023, based on EPA TRI filings.
- Hiland Dairy Foods LLC's off-site transfers fell from 6.4 thousand lb in 2022 to 3.2 thousand lb in 2023, based on EPA TRI filings.
